110+ Irish Dog Names

Naming a dog can sometimes seem like a daunting task, so before settling on a name, be sure to consider factors such as your new puppy’s physical characteristics, personality, and coat. Just like giving a name to a child, you will also want to think about how easy it is to pronounce the name (this may be even more important when giving a name to a dog, as you want to be sure that he or she will recognize her name), as well as that the fact that it should be a name that you can share with friends, family, and the vet. Also, keep in mind that you don’t have to give your dog a name right away – it can sometimes be helpful to wait until you get to know him better before making your final decision.

Irish dog names are so funny, so playful, and definitely unique. Currently, the most spoken language in Ireland is English, but Irish, also called Gaelic or Irish Gaelic, is still the official language. If you are unfamiliar with Celtic languages, pronunciation may seem difficult at first. However, all names will convey a beautiful sound and a touch of Irish essence.

Gaelic Dog Names

fred.and.georgeee/ Instagram
  • Lorcan (little wild one)
  • Bran (raven)
  • Murphy (hound of the sea)
  • Seamus
  • Connor
  • Rogan (red-haired)
  • Keeva (gentle and precious)
  • Sullivan
  • Kieran
  • Conry (king of the hounds)
  • Saoirse (freedom – pronounced SEER-sha)
  • Dermot
  • Declan
  • Selkie (for a black dog, perhaps)
  • Madigan (little dog)
  • Aislinn or Aisling (dream – pronounced ASH-lin)
  • Felan or Phelan (wolf – spelled Faolan in Gaelic)
  • Cael (slender)
  • Conan (hound)
  • Roisin (little rose)
